Alterar valores de jogos em Flash
Um script beeeeem simples que envia o PID do plugin do Flash para o scanmem.
Caso não o tenha, digite: sudo apt-get install scanmem
Para quem nunca usou o scanmem, segue um tutorial bem básico:
- Acesse um jogo em flash de qualquer site pelo Firefox (nesse exemplo, vou usar um jogo em que eu começo com 100 de gold e o objetivo é conseguir 99999 gold)
- Execute o scanflash.sh assim: sh scanflash.sh
- Digite sua senha de admin
- Digite: 100
- Ele vai escanear a memória e mostrar a quantidade de resultados que ele encontrou
- Volte para o jogo e faça com que esse valor mude (no caso, vamos comprar um item de 10 gold, assim ficaremos com 90 gold)
- Volte para o terminal e digite: 90
- Se ele mostrar a seguinte mensagem:
info: we currently have 1 matches.
info: match identified, use "set" to modify value.
info: enter "help" for other commands.
Ele encontrou a posição do valor procurado e está pronto para editar.
- Digite: set 99999
- Pronto, volte para o jogo e confira
Caso não o tenha, digite: sudo apt-get install scanmem
Para quem nunca usou o scanmem, segue um tutorial bem básico:
- Acesse um jogo em flash de qualquer site pelo Firefox (nesse exemplo, vou usar um jogo em que eu começo com 100 de gold e o objetivo é conseguir 99999 gold)
- Execute o scanflash.sh assim: sh scanflash.sh
- Digite sua senha de admin
- Digite: 100
- Ele vai escanear a memória e mostrar a quantidade de resultados que ele encontrou
- Volte para o jogo e faça com que esse valor mude (no caso, vamos comprar um item de 10 gold, assim ficaremos com 90 gold)
- Volte para o terminal e digite: 90
- Se ele mostrar a seguinte mensagem:
info: we currently have 1 matches.
info: match identified, use "set" to modify value.
info: enter "help" for other commands.
Ele encontrou a posição do valor procurado e está pronto para editar.
- Digite: set 99999
- Pronto, volte para o jogo e confira
Descrição
Um script beeeeem simples que envia o PID do plugin do Flash para o scanmem.
Caso não o tenha, digite: sudo apt-get install scanmem
Para quem nunca usou o scanmem, segue um tutorial bem básico:
- Acesse um jogo em flash de qualquer site pelo Firefox (nesse exemplo, vou usar um jogo em que eu começo com 100 de gold e o objetivo é conseguir 99999 gold)
- Execute o scanflash.sh assim: sh scanflash.sh
- Digite sua senha de admin
- Digite: 100
- Ele vai escanear a memória e mostrar a quantidade de resultados que ele encontrou
- Volte para o jogo e faça com que esse valor mude (no caso, vamos comprar um item de 10 gold, assim ficaremos com 90 gold)
- Volte para o terminal e digite: 90
- Se ele mostrar a seguinte mensagem:
info: we currently have 1 matches.
info: match identified, use "set" to modify value.
info: enter "help" for other commands.
Ele encontrou a posição do valor procurado e está pronto para editar.
- Digite: set 99999
- Pronto, volte para o jogo e confira
Caso não o tenha, digite: sudo apt-get install scanmem
Para quem nunca usou o scanmem, segue um tutorial bem básico:
- Acesse um jogo em flash de qualquer site pelo Firefox (nesse exemplo, vou usar um jogo em que eu começo com 100 de gold e o objetivo é conseguir 99999 gold)
- Execute o scanflash.sh assim: sh scanflash.sh
- Digite sua senha de admin
- Digite: 100
- Ele vai escanear a memória e mostrar a quantidade de resultados que ele encontrou
- Volte para o jogo e faça com que esse valor mude (no caso, vamos comprar um item de 10 gold, assim ficaremos com 90 gold)
- Volte para o terminal e digite: 90
- Se ele mostrar a seguinte mensagem:
info: we currently have 1 matches.
info: match identified, use "set" to modify value.
info: enter "help" for other commands.
Ele encontrou a posição do valor procurado e está pronto para editar.
- Digite: set 99999
- Pronto, volte para o jogo e confira
Versões atualizadas deste script
#!/bin/bash processID=`ps -e | egrep "plugin-containe" | egrep -o "^ [0-9]+"` sudo scanmem -p $processID
#!/bin/bash
processID=`ps -e | egrep "plugin-containe" | egrep ".+\?" -o | egrep [0-9]+ -o`
sudo scanmem -p $processID